Week 51

12/19: Coffee Talk
I started with the self-titled EP from 2020 and then checked out the new single. Dogs and weekends are two things we both have in common. Fast, melodic pop punk. The new single has me ready for what comes next! Favorite Track: Clean Slate

12/20: Totally Cashed
New music Tuesday? I checked out the new EP, Totally Totally Cashed Cashed. Being that y’all are from Chicago, I have questions about the bagels. It’s 70s/80s punk rock vibes. Fun little EP. Favorite Track: Sport Drink

12/21: Fair Do’s
New music Wednesday? I listened to the new EP, 1000 Miles. Rip-roaring melodic hardcore. Well done. Favorite Track: 1000 Miles

12/22: Have Near
New music Thursday? I listened to the new EP, Nature//Nurture. It’s like a hammock hang in the middle of winter. It’s a vibe. Dreampop/shoegaze/emo, post something. Favorite Track: Daydreaming

12/23: Lost Like Lions
New music Friday! I listened to the new EP, Fear of Letting Go. Pop punk-ish with some emo vibes? Favorite Track: Back to Life

12/24: Autumn Fires
New music Saturday? I listened to new EP, Sunnyside. It’s extra pop punk. Favorite Track: Sunnyside

12/25: Other Half
New music Sunday? I listened to the new full length, Soft Action. File under rip-roaring noise punk/hardcore. Push play and see if you can look away. Favorite Track: Slab Thick or Grisly Visions or Losing the Whip…or all of them.
